The name Luxie has seen a varied but steady presence in the United States over the past decade and a half, with a total of 39 babies born with this unique moniker since 2006.

In 2006, the name made its first appearance on birth certificates that year with five newborns sharing the name Luxie. This number doubled by 2011 when eight little ones were welcomed into the world with this distinctive name.

The following year, in 2012, Luxie's popularity peaked in the United States with ten babies being born that year bearing this name. However, this peak was not sustained as the number of births decreased to six in 2013 and then stabilized at five births per year in both 2014 and 2020.
